About the Voith Group
The Voith Group is a global technology company. With its broad portfolio of systems, products, services and digital applications, Voith sets standards in the markets of energy, paper, raw materials and transport & automotive. Founded in 1867, the company today has around 22,000 employees, sales of € 5,2 billion and locations in over 60 countries worldwide and is thus one of the larger family-owned companies in Europe.

Summary - Summary
The Hydropower Hydraulic Controls Service Engineer is responsible for providing expert technical service and support for hydraulic control systems used in hydroelectric power plants throughout North America. This includes commissioning, troubleshooting, maintenance, and upgrades of hydraulic power units (HPUs), governors, and associated control systems. The incumbent works closely with customers to ensure reliable and efficient operation of hydro plant hydraulic controls, while also identifying opportunities to expand the service business and deliver best-in-class customer support.
